73, Tied by Washington DC duplex cancel 27 Dec 1863 on a censored Civil War pasted down folded sheet cover. Addr to a Confederate POW, at CARROLL PRISON in Washington. Notation at top reads "THE PRISONER WHOSE NAME IS ON THE BACK OF THIS LETTER HAS BEEN RELEASED ON TAKEN THE OATH OF ALLEGIANCE / W.P.W. SUPT OCP" (Warren P. Wood, Superintendent of Capitol Prison). Has various m/s details on reverse. After the war Warren Wood would become the Chief of the US Secret Service. A RARE USE OF A BLACK JACK ON PRISONER OF WAR MAIL. F. Has 1978 Philatelic Foundation Certificate (Image)
